fre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于c51單片機(jī)的電子密碼鎖課程設(shè)計(jì)-wenkub.com

2025-06-24 17:49 本頁(yè)面
   

【正文】 } else l_code=(l_code1)|0x01。0xf0)|0x0f。0x10)!=0) { KeyPort=l_code。 if((KeyPortamp。 //定時(shí)器關(guān) } }unsigned char KeyScan(void){ unsigned char l_code,h_code。 delay_count2++。 //總中斷打開 ET1=1。 //定時(shí)器關(guān) }}void Init_Timer1(void){ TMOD |= 0x10。 delay_count1++。 EA=1。 DIG4=1。 //取顯示數(shù)據(jù),段碼3 Delay(2)。 DIG2=1。 DataPort=TempData[2]。 //清空數(shù)據(jù),防止有交替重影 DIG1=1。 DIG4=1。 DataPort=0xff。 DIG3=1。y)。 for(x=z。 if(i==5) i=0。 // E TempData[1]=0x88。 //定時(shí)器1開關(guān)打開 } } clr_flag=1。 // E TempData[1]=0x88。//3 count=0。 if(count==3) { TempData[0]=0x86。 // n P23=1。if(Flag){ TempData[0]=0xc0。(temp[j]==password[j])。//先把比較位置1for(j=0。 TempData[i]=0x89。 c_flag=0。j4。 TempData[i1]=dofly_DuanMa[num]。amp。num==11amp。 default:break。 case 0x44:num=10。 case 0x14:num=8。 case 0x42:num=6。 case 0x12:num=4。 case 0x41:num=2。 } } switch(key) { case 0x11:num=0。 while(key_flag) { if(clr_flag==1) { clr_flag=0。 // TempData[3]=0xbf。j++) { TempData[j]=0xff。 delay_count1=0。 clr_flag=0。 i=0。 unsigned char temp[4]。//鍵盤掃描void Init_Timer0(void)。unsigned char c_flag。 //存儲(chǔ)顯示值的全局變量unsigned char time_flag。sbit P23=P2^3。sbit DIG4=P3^4。最重要的是我通過(guò)親自設(shè)計(jì),親自繪制原理圖,印制電路板以及系統(tǒng)調(diào)試培養(yǎng)了我的耐心和細(xì)心,這對(duì)我以后的工作和學(xué)習(xí)有很大的幫助。7 總 結(jié)經(jīng)過(guò)三周的緊張?jiān)O(shè)計(jì),終于順利完成了設(shè)計(jì)任務(wù)。 圖15 顯示子程序流程圖6 系統(tǒng)調(diào)試在本次軟件調(diào)試中,我們使用的是STC_ISP_V481C51單片機(jī)下載工具和Keil uVision2軟件,Keil uVision2是美國(guó)Keil Software公司出品的51系列兼容單片機(jī)C語(yǔ)言軟件開發(fā)系統(tǒng),使用接近于傳統(tǒng)c語(yǔ)言的語(yǔ)法來(lái)開發(fā),與匯編相比,C語(yǔ)言在功能上、結(jié)構(gòu)性、可讀性、可維護(hù)性上有明顯的優(yōu)勢(shì),因而易學(xué)易用,而且大大的提高了工作效率和項(xiàng)目開發(fā)周期,他還能嵌入?yún)R編,您可以在關(guān)鍵的位置嵌入,使程序達(dá)到接近于匯編的工作效率。圖15為修改密碼流程圖。其密碼輸入和比較判決流程圖如圖13所示。密碼鎖系統(tǒng)軟件設(shè)計(jì)主要包括主程序模塊、密碼比較判斷模塊、鍵盤掃描模塊、修改密碼模塊、數(shù)碼管顯示模塊等及按鍵檢測(cè)模塊。硬件電路如圖10所示 圖10 固態(tài)繼電器驅(qū)動(dòng)電路 報(bào)警提示電路報(bào)警提示電路采用小蜂鳴器提示。(5) 固態(tài)繼電器對(duì)過(guò)載有較大的敏感性,必須用快速熔斷器或RC阻尼電路對(duì)其進(jìn)行過(guò)載保護(hù)。 固態(tài)繼電器的缺點(diǎn)(1)導(dǎo)通后的管壓降大,可控硅或雙相控硅的正向降壓可達(dá)1~2V,大功率晶體管的飽和壓降也在1~2V之間,一般功率場(chǎng)效應(yīng)管的導(dǎo)通電阻也較機(jī)械觸點(diǎn)的接觸電阻大。 (2) 靈敏度高,控制功率小,電磁兼容性好:固態(tài)繼電器的輸入電壓范圍較寬,驅(qū)動(dòng)功率低,可與大多數(shù)邏輯集成電路兼容不需加緩沖器或驅(qū)動(dòng)器。固態(tài)繼電器的輸入與輸出電路的隔離和耦合方式有光電耦合和變壓器耦合兩種。固態(tài)繼電器的輸入端用微小的控制信號(hào),達(dá)到直接驅(qū)動(dòng)大電流負(fù)載。本次設(shè)計(jì)選用動(dòng)態(tài)顯示。再把多個(gè)這樣的8字裝在一起就成了多位的數(shù)碼管了 。鍵盤電路硬件連接圖如圖6所示。每一條水平(行線)與垂直線(列線)的交叉處不相通,而是通過(guò)一個(gè)按鍵來(lái)連通,利用這種行列式矩陣結(jié)構(gòu)只需要M條行線和N條列線,即可組成具有MN個(gè)按鍵的鍵盤。 圖4時(shí)鐘電路復(fù)位是單片機(jī)的初始化操作,只需在單片機(jī)的復(fù)位引腳加上大于2個(gè)機(jī)器周期的高電平就可使單片機(jī)復(fù)位,當(dāng)程序運(yùn)行出錯(cuò)或操作進(jìn)入死循環(huán)狀態(tài)可通過(guò)復(fù)位重新啟動(dòng)程序。下面則分別介紹這三部分的選取。當(dāng)用戶輸入的密碼正確時(shí),單片機(jī)便輸出開門信號(hào),送到繼電器驅(qū)動(dòng)電路,然后驅(qū)動(dòng)繼電器常開觸點(diǎn)閉合,達(dá)到開門的目的。根據(jù)本次課程設(shè)計(jì)的實(shí)際情況,兼顧經(jīng)濟(jì)性、使用性、簡(jiǎn)單易行、操作簡(jiǎn)單等多方面因素,本次課程設(shè)計(jì)采用方案一來(lái)完成。具有雙工UART串行通道。 輸入按扭開關(guān)組輸入鎖存電路密碼存儲(chǔ)電路開鎖控制電路機(jī)械動(dòng)作構(gòu)件5秒定時(shí)電路20秒定時(shí)電路聲光指示電路圖2 數(shù)字邏輯控制方案電子密碼鎖原理框圖 方案比較及確定 由于利用單片機(jī)靈活的編程設(shè)計(jì)和強(qiáng)大的I/O端口,及其控制的準(zhǔn)確性,不但能實(shí)現(xiàn)基本的密碼鎖功能,還可以增添掉電存儲(chǔ)、聲光提示等功能,故選用方案一。3 系統(tǒng)方案設(shè)計(jì)及確定 系統(tǒng)方案的提出本次課程設(shè)計(jì)的密碼鎖電路主要由四
點(diǎn)擊復(fù)制文檔內(nèi)容
法律信息相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1